Global Smart Language Model Market Size and Forecast – 2026-2033
Coherent Market Insights estimates that the global smart language model market is expected to reach USD 9 Bn in 2026 and will expand to USD 53 Bn by 2033, registering a CAGR of 24% between 2026 and 2033.
Key Takeaways of the Smart Language Model Market
- The foundation language models segment is expected to account for 56% of the smart language model market share in 2026.
- The cloud-based APIs segment is estimated to hold 42% of the market share in 2026.
- The customer support and virtual assistants segment is projected to capture 33% of the global smart language model market share in 2026.
- North America will dominate the smart language model market in 2026 with an estimated 45% share.
- Asia Pacific will hold 23% share in 2026 and is expected to record the fastest growth over the forecast period.

Why Does Foundation Language Models Segment Dominate the Global Smart Language Model Market?
The foundation language models segment is expected to account for 56.0% of the global smart language model market share in 2026. The growth is mainly because of their ability to serve as a universal base for a wide range of downstream applications. Starting from broad data exposure, these systems learn patterns through prolonged training sequences instead of narrow examples. Because they adapt easily, firms apply them widely when handling diverse linguistic challenges. Their value appears most clearly where custom solutions would demand excessive effort otherwise.
For instance, on September 29, 2025, Apple introduced its Foundation Models framework to allow developers to build intelligent features into apps using Apple’s on‑device LLM technology.
(Source: apple.com)

North America Smart Language Model Market Analysis and Trends
The North America region is projected to lead the market with a 45% share in 2026. Growth emerges from a stable network of technological resources, where respected AI research centers combine with consistent funding from venture sources. Innovation moves faster because major firms like Google, Microsoft, and IBM refine advanced language systems for varied fields - healthcare, finance, customer support included. Support comes not only from private enterprise but also from policy frameworks that favor artificial intelligence expansion, along with widespread upgrades to cloud-based platforms. A significant benefit emerges from North America's strong pool of experts dedicated to machine learning and natural language processing. Momentum builds where academic discoveries meet real-world implementation, allowing rapid deployment of smart linguistic systems. As collaboration spans industries, development moves forward without slowing. Growth persists through shared effort rather than isolated achievement.
For instance, on December 9, 2025, Block, Anthropic, OpenAI, and other leaders in AI announced the launch of Agentic AI Foundation (AAIF) to ensure agentic AI develops as an open, collaborative ecosystem.
(Source: block.xyz)

Key Developments
- On January 12, 2026, Apple announced a partnership with Google to power its artificial intelligence features, including a major Siri upgrade. The multiyear partnership will lean on Google’s Gemini and cloud technology for future Apple foundational models
- On December 31, 2025, SoftBank Group Corp. announced that it had completed an additional investment of USD 22.5 billion in OpenAI, at the second closing of The Company’s investment of up to USD 40.0 billion.

Global Smart Language Model Market Driver - Growing Evolution of Edge Computing
The accelerating advancement of edge computing is significantly propelling the adoption and development of smart language models across various industries. As edge computing enables data processing closer to the source of data generation, it addresses critical challenges related to latency, bandwidth constraints, and data privacy that traditional cloud-centric models often face. Operating across distributed networks makes advanced language systems faster on handheld gadgets, smartwatches, or connected machines. Where signals are weak or unstable, instant comprehension of speech still occurs. Efficiency improves when processing happens locally instead of relying solely on distant servers. Understanding context in everyday language remains possible without constant internet access. Performance gains emerge through reduced dependency on centralized hubs.
For instance, on May 19, 2025, Qualcomm Technologies, Inc announced a collaboration with Advantech to advance AI-driven IoT applications. Through this collaboration, Advantech is positioned as a partner in Qualcomm Technologies’ IoT ecosystem, enabling deeper integration of Qualcomm Technologies’ cutting-edge technologies into Advantech’s edge computing and edge AI platforms, accelerating the deployment of intelligent solutions across industries.
(Source: qualcomm.com)
Global Smart Language Model Market Opportunity - Rising Scope of Expansion Across Multiple Sectors
Growth in the global smart language model market stems from wider use across many industries. Because firms aim to automate tasks, engage users more effectively, one key solution gaining ground is intelligent language processing. Steady growth marks how widely these tools now operate - spanning healthcare, finance, retail, education, and assistance networks. In medical settings, they contribute by interpreting symptoms, managing conversations with patients, documenting visits, which sharpens accuracy while cutting time. Financial institutions use them differently: detecting irregular transactions, analyzing sentiment within messages, answering client questions - outcomes include tighter monitoring and more fluid exchanges.
